MUTUAL BENEFIT SOCIETY

OF BALTIMORE. MARYLAND
407-9-11-13 WEST FRANKLIN STREET (Franklin and Jasper Streets)

Vernon 0624
Office Hours—9 A. M. to 3 P. M. Daily, except Saturday. 9 A. M. to 12 M.

HARRY O. WILSON. Founder
Incorporated under the Laws of the State of Maryland. May 1st. 1903

Started Business June 15th, 1903

To Care for YOU when Sick, and Provide for Your WIDOW and CHILDREN when You are DEAD
Reasons Why You Should Join the

MUTUAL BENEFIT SOCIETY

1. It is Not Organized for Profit.

2. The Dues are Small, and it is Your Duty to Protect Your Family against Sickness and Death

3. If you have No Friends or Relatives, you can direct the Society to apply the Death Benefit
to your Burial, and in whatever Cemetery you may direct.

4. The MUTUAL BENEFIT SOCIETY is a Home Concern, having been incorporated in the
State of Maryland Its Main Office is located in the State.

5. It is an Old Established Society, with an Unblemished Reputation for Honesty and Fairness.

6. It is one of the Most Popular Societies in Baltimore and the State of Maryland. You are
safe with your membership with us.

7. All its Claims ARE ADJUSTED PROMPTLY.

8. Has on Deposit with the State Insurance Commissioner TEN THOUSAND DOLLARS
($10,000 00) for the protection of its Policy-holders.
